About this series

Green Dreams is the third novel of this award-winning author's post-apocalyptic epic Black Dreams Series. 

 

Islander families fragmented during the chaotic plague years either through death, dislocation, or baby-hungry kidnappings now seek to salvage some sense of wholeness. Waverly's search is for her daughter, kidnapped eight years ago by mainlanders. In the last book, Black Dreams, Silver Linings, her search turned up a brother she had thought long dead. Her niece also resurfaced. And while Waverly's search for her daughter continues to be frustrated, new information gleaned through plague gifts and plague survivors give her new leads and renewed hope.

 

The worst of the plague years are over, yet isolated cases still occur. Mainlanders abhor the mere mention of the plague to the point of denying outbreaks in their midst. On the other hand, islanders continue their controversial research into what they consider the plague's coveted gifts. The intriguing dimension of consciousness reached during the plague delirium is explored via lucid dreaming techniques, brain wave training, and archetypal dream interpretation. This, in turn, leads to a discovery by islanders of yet another way to access this rich dimension and another way for families like Waverly's to return to a sense of wholeness.

    Cataclysm and Rebirth is the first novel of this award-winning author's, post-apocalyptic epic, the Black Dreams Series.   The year:  2030. The setting:  a grand opening gala at the remodeled San Francisco mansion--Belle's Art Gallery and Inn. All is aglitter when out of the blue Belle and family are spun into chaos by a climate-triggered earthquake and tsunami that devastate San Francisco. Pandemonium ensues, only intensified by the mixed-blessing birth of three "earthquake babies," which Belle and husband struggle to raise in the tumultuous aftermath.   Once relative calm is restored, the world is rocked by yet another climate-triggered event--this time illness and infertility. Belle's determination to survive, to maintain her hotel/art gallery, her suddenly expanded family, and her art career, she relies heavily on environmental journalist husband, Forrest, and physician friend, Rush Rorrie.     Black Dreams, Silver Linings is the second book of this award-winning author's post-apocalyptic epic, The Black Dreams Series.   In a post-plague, baby-hungry world Waverly searches for her kidnapped daughter. She works as a tour guide on what mainlanders call Devil's Island--all that's left of a future San Francisco. The island is infamous for its high rate of plague survivors, its thriving arts community, and its suspect spirituality.   Islanders are fascinated by mysterious "plague gifts"--knowledge and skills acquired by surviving the plague and are covertly experimenting with the virus. Mainlanders abhor the mere mention of anything plague-related.   The island is quarantined, yet mainlanders Dr. Lourdes and his daughters insist on a visit. Their stated agenda is to shop the arts district and to adopt a child. But Dr. Lourdes' curiosity about rumored plague virus experiments has Waverly worried about the true purpose of their visit.   When the doctor's youngest daughter contracts the plague, Waverly must call on all her plague gifts to help her survive.
